所谓T细胞耗竭(T Cell Exhaustion)就是指常见慢性感染和癌症患者体内T细胞功能丧失。由于长期暴露于持续性抗原或慢性炎症,疲惫的T细胞逐渐失去效应功能,记忆T细胞特征也开始缺失。不过这种耗竭是可以逆转的,至少部分逆转,主要是通过阻止PD-1之类的抑制性通路。 TEx Are a...

T-cell exhaustion was originally identified during chronic infection in mice, and was subsequently observed in humans with cancer. The exhausted T cells in the tumor microenvironment show overexpressed inhibitory receptors, decreased effector cytokine pr
